What a clever little big car this is.

Its got more features than an E, and really useful ones too - quite unlike some manufacturers we know that throw in a ton of barely functioning gizmos. What is obvious is the serious amount of thought that has gone into each feature - I loved the removable trunk-lamp/torch, something I wished SUV manufacturers would provide given their 'outdoor' positioning. The swing-out trailer hitch is another. You have to give credit to a manufacturer that has taken the trouble to think on your behalf - to the extent of relocating the famous umbrellas to a more sensible position.

The styling is a tasteful study in understated elegance, too. Overall this is a potential giant-killer car - comfortably punching its way 2 segments above its own.

What a car! I doubt how many of these clever features would trickle down to the Indian variants but regardless, the new generation Superb looks amazing and sheds the looooong limo-esque image. Some of the features are very thoughtful - like the removable boot light-cum-torch, the telescopic plastic cover for the boot struts, the tablet mount and the 230V AC socket. And they aren't very expensive to implement either. I only wish an analog clock made it to the dash somewhere just like the Passat.
